There are many health benefits to working out, especially when it comes to core exercises. Here are five great exercises – both common and unusual – aimed at strengthening the centre of the body – as well as a lesson in why they are so good for your core.

Core exercises focus on the abdominal area, the lower back, pelvis and hip area. They can be done anywhere without any equipment and build up over time, increasing fitness and muscle tone. It can take a lot of effort, particularly initially but the results are well worth it, improving strength, endurance and movement.
